Kandal M Venture Limited (NASDAQ:FMFC – Get Free Report) saw a large growth in short interest in June. As of June 30th, there was short interest totaling 527,618 shares, a growth of 10,267.8% from the June 15th total of 5,089 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 13,989,128 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.0 days. Currently, 4.1% of the company’s stock are sold short.

Kandal M Venture Trading Up 2.6%
Kandal M Venture stock traded up $0.01 during mid-day trading on Friday, reaching $0.28. 81,134 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 7,064,788. The firm’s fifty day moving average is $0.34 and its two-hundred day moving average is $0.37. Kandal M Venture has a fifty-two week low of $0.23 and a fifty-two week high of $15.75.
